Scalable Uat Execution Framework for B2b Applications with Data-dependent Entry/exit Criteria using Sql Query Hooks
| Author(s) | Udayan Verma |
|---|---|
| Country | United States |
| Abstract | The current report is forward-looking automation architecture with Business-to-Business (B2B) applications being optimized through SQL query hooks as data reliant entry and exit points to the User Acceptance Testing (UAT). Conventional UAT systems are unlikely to work with a dynamic backend data environment and introduce such inefficiencies as premature test execution and premature validation of a database change. The suggested scheme, entails SQL-based gating functions in the automation stream of events and ascertains that the testing procedure stipulates the fulfillment of the preconditioned data circumstances and ceases when the checking of the entirety of the demanded transitions of the backend outlooks has been executed. This data-driven execution model improves the reliability of data testing by excluding the false positives, less human control and gives accurate points of test to go/no-go decision-making. This framework is a strong platform that supports the enhancement of the quality assurance procedures in complex B2B ecosystems because it can support large data volumes and scale tests without issues, besides being compatible with continuous integration and delivery (CI/CD) pipelines. |
